UNILAG Post UTME Cut off Mark – The University of Lagos – popularly known as Unilag – is a federal government research university in Lagos State, southwestern Nigeria which was established in 1962.

UNILAG Post UTME Cut Off Mark 2021/2022
Please be informed that at the time of writing this article, UNILAG Post-UTME cut-off mark for 2021/2022 academic session has not been released. Although, the 2018/2019 Post UTME cut off mark was 180.
